Highlights
Are people in Mobile older or younger than people in Paducah?
- The Median Age in Mobile is 5.9 years younger than in Paducah.

Are housing costs cheaper in Mobile or Paducah?
- Mobile housing costs are 7.8% more expensive than Paducah hous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Mobile or Paducah?
- The average commute for residents of Mobile is 3.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Paducah.

 Paducah, KYMobile, ALUnited States
 Population26,248187,445329,725,481
 Median Income$42,024$44,780$69,021
 Median Age43.737.838.4
 Avg. Home Price$163,200$176,000$338,100
 Unemployment Rate6.2%6.2%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time18.6921.926.38
